Five new characters have been added to the ever-expanding regular cast, and all of the unique modes from the previous games have been brought back, along with the addition of a combat minigame and a platforming game called “Devil Within,” which star Jin Kazama in their own separate stories. Tekken 5 is a fighting game that is more similar to past iterations of the series due to reducing the odd stage design characteristics introduced in its immediate predecessor.
